We are starting to see Securitised Token Offering's replace Initial Coin Offering's as a method of funding business startups. They offer a better deal to investors as they act like traditional shares and carry ownership and voting rights. In the future ICO's are likely to be limited to applications where they act as money such as platform coins or utility tokrens.
